tpwallet_tpwallet官网下载-tp官方下载安卓最新版本/TP官方网址下载
引言:本文面向开发者与产品经理,逐步说明如何添加 TPWallet 钱包账号,并从实时支付验证、多种技术栈、版本控制、预言机、货币转移、创新技术转型与高效支付分析系统等方面做综合性探讨。
一、添加 TPWallet 账号的实操步骤
1) 安装与准备:下载官方 TPWallet 应用或引入 TPWallet SDK,确保来源可信并校验签名。2) 创建/导入账号:选择“创建新钱包”生成助记词(强制备份),或“恢复钱包”粘贴助记词/私钥/Keystore。3) 设置安全:设置 PIN、生物识别或多重签名,启用助记词离线备份。4) 配置网络与代币:添加主链(如 Ethereum、BSC、Tron 等)和自定义 RPC,导入代币合约地址。5) 授权与连接:使用 WalletConnect 或内置 dApp 浏览器与应用授权连接。
二、实时支付验证
- 链上确认策略:根据风险级别选择 0~N 个区块确认;对小额即时展示预估成功并监听交易回执。- 事件订阅:使用 WebSocket /推送服务(如 Alchemy/Infura/QuickNode)监听 pending 与 txReceipt,实现实时到账通知。- 第二层与支付通道:采用 L2、Rollup 和状态通道减少确认延迟、降低手续费。- 防重放与幂等:用 nonce、idempotency-key 与服务端事务保证重复请求幂等性。
三、多种技术选型
- 客户端:Web3.js、ethers.js、TPWallet SDK、WalletConnect。- 后端:RPC 节点、高可用负载均衡、缓存(Redis)、消息队列(Kafka)。- 数据层:链索引器(The Graph、自建 indexer)、ClickHouse/Timescale 用于分析。- 安全:硬件签名(HSM)、多方计算(MPC)、智能合约审计工具(Slither、MythX)。
四、版本控制与合约升级
- 合约语义化版本控制(SemVer),在部署流水线中记录 ABI、bytecode、迁移脚本。- 升级模式:透明代理(Transparent Proxy)、可升级代理(UUPS)或新合约迁移并保留数据迁移脚本。- CI/CD:使用 Git + pre-commit、自动化测试、模拟链(Hardhat/Foundry)和链上回归测试。
五、预言机(Oracles)的应用与风险


- 用途:为支付和结算提供外部价格、汇率、KYC、清算触发器等。- 方案:去中心化预言机(Chainlink、Band)、自建守护节点或混合模式。- 风险控制:多源聚合、去中心化排序、经济激励与罚没机制、跌幅保护。
六、货币转移流程要点
- 转账签名流程:构建 tx -> 本地/远端签名 -> 广播 -> 监听回执。- 代币操作:ERC-20/ERC-721 的 approve/transferFrom 模式,注意授权最小化与合约白名单。- 跨链:使用桥或中继,关注验证模型(信任委托、轻客户端、阈值签名)与滑点/手续费。- 费用优化:Gas 估算、批处理、打包与合并付款。
七、创新科技与业务转型
- 支付即合约:将业务规则放入链上合约实现自动结算与可组合性。- 可编程货币与 tokenization:支持稳定币、可回收通证、奖励机制,结合 DeFi 提升流动性。- 隐私与合规:引入零知识证明、选择性披露与链下 KYC/AML 联动。
八、高效支付分析系统设计
- 实时数据管道:节点 -> Kafka -> 流处理(Flink)-> OLAP(ClickHouse)/Dashboard(Grafana)。- 指标体系:TPS、确认时间、失败率、手续费分布、对账差异与异常检测。- 报表与合规:自动对账、审计日志、取证链上数据快照。- 智能告警:基于阈值与 ML 的异常检测(重复 tx、漏单、异常滑点)。
九、实践建议与落地要点
- 安全优先:强制助记词离线备份、MPC/HSM、常态化审计与渗透测试。- 用户体验:简化签名流程、抽象 gas、提供 fiat on-ramp。- 兼顾合规:根据区域接入 KYC/AML,日志可追溯但保护隐私。- 监控与演练:建立故障演练、回滚流程和资金紧急领取流程。
结语:添加 TPWallet 账号看似简单,但在生产环境下涉及实时验证、跨https://www.dihongsc.com ,链与合约版本管理、预言机安全、资金流与分析体系等复杂因素。建议以模块化架构、小步迭代并强化监控与安全,逐步把钱包功能从“工具”升级为“高效、可审计的支付平台”。